Tomas, 

If you aren't sure that the licenses have been freed up, you can run a
command that will show you every client that is tying up one of your
licenses.  That way you know for sure if the definition that you deleted
is tying up one of your licenses.  If it is, like Mathew said, you will
have to delete all client definitions for that client, noting all
relevant information (especially the client-id).   Once you know that
you have a free SAP license, you can add all of the non-SAP definitions
for that client back into the server. 

nsrlic -vvv 

(very verbose mode), and it will give you something similar to this.  I
don't' have SAP, but do use SQL, so this is what I see:    

NetWorker Module for Microsoft SQL Server
                     Available: 27
                          Used: 24
                     Remaining: 3
             Connected Clients: servername, servername,
                                Servername, servername,
                                Servername, servername,
Servername, servername,           
                                Servername, servername,
                                           .....
                                Servername27;

Hey Tomas,

I'm just guessing here as you haven't given much detail, but I'd say
that you probably have multiple client definitions for the client that
you only removed the SAP backup client definition for that client. To
free up the licenses consumed by a client you will need to delete all of
that clients' definitions, you probably want to take note of things like
the client ID and other settings, if you want to then re-create the
other client definitions - some people on the list have also reported
that a restart of NetWorker may be necessary - I have never had to do
this, but it could be related to the version of NetWorker that they were
running

Hello,







I need to configure one SAP backup. My problems seems to be with
licenses ...











NetWorker Module for SAP R/3 Oracle, Unix Client/1



                     Available: 23



                          Used: 23



                     Remaining: 0







I see that I don't have more SAP licenses but at first I deleted old SAP

configuration but I still see Used: 23 licenses and I can't configure
new

SAP backup.







Do you know how to refresh license? Right now should be Used: 22 because
I

deleted one SAP configuration ...
